Abstract
The first thioalkyne derivatives of functionalised titanocene of formula [Ti(η5-C5H4R′)(η5-C5H4R″)(SC
CR)2] (R = But, R′ = R″ = SiMe3 1a; R = Ph, R′ = R″ = SiMe3 1b; R = But, R′ = SiMe3, R″ = PPh2 2a; R = But, R′ = R″ = PPh2 3a) have been prepared by reaction of [Ti(η5-C5H4R′)(η5-C5H4R″)Cl2] and LiSC
CR in diethyl ether. Complexes 1a and 2a have been used as precursors in the synthesis of Ti–M (M = d6 or d8 metal) heteronuclear complexes showing different co-ordination modes. All compounds have been characterised by elemental analysis and 1H, 31P, 19F and 13C NMR and infrared spectroscopy. The crystal structures of two complexes have been solved.
